Paxful Founder Faces Prison Time for Lack of Anti-Money Laundering Controls

Paxful co-founder Artur Schaback has pleaded guilty to knowingly failing to implement and maintain an effective anti-money laundering program at the cryptocurrency exchange. This is a serious offense that can facilitate criminal activities like terrorism and drug trafficking. As a result, Schaback has agreed to pay a $5 million fine and faces up to five years in prison when he is sentenced on November 4. Stay tuned for more updates on this developing story.
